Soroban DS is an educational title for the Nintendo DS that focuses on teaching users the traditional Japanese abacus, known as the soroban. Released exclusively in Japan, this game aims to provide an interactive way to learn and practice mental arithmetic skills, which aligns with the genre of educational gaming prevalent on the platform. While specific developer and publisher details are not widely documented, the game's intent is clear in its focus on learning rather than conventional gameplay mechanics found in typical video games.

In Soroban DS, players engage with the soroban through various exercises that help improve their calculation speed and accuracy.
